Output 8c21430d1fa6623dd8ee99c2f7d29b8ac0b1f1ac2895ae38517e1f2abb2f90a5:3

value
61641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b2985de38a4224a5aa895aa30892d4e85a748d OP_EQUAL
address
3QujWHAYDBUBnBGw7AjS3wtMacS97z9zjn
transaction
8c21430d1fa6623dd8ee99c2f7d29b8ac0b1f1ac2895ae38517e1f2abb2f90a5
spent
true